To realize the quantitative evaluation of paper handling machines, we have developed original test media, the base material of which uses highly durable synthetic paper. With a special surface printing process and new technologies employed, the flexible and quantitative control of the specific characteristics of the media is ensured. Seven of them (the friction coefficient, deformation, thickness, scratch resistance, stiffness, anti-static performance, and adhesion of the medium to the rubber roller) greatly influence the paper handling performance of machines, The technology of friction coefficient control, in particular among them, is expected to be used for other applications as well. The inspection using these test media makes it possible to evaluate the paper handling performance of machines according to each medium characteristic quantitatively. Therefore, a reduction in the period of product development and the accumulation of reliable technologies as advantages are expected. Furthermore, a reduction in the processing period of products is expected from the production side as well along with the manufacture of high-quality products.
